The Oregon Department of Revenue is recruiting an Administrative Specialist 2 for the Personal Tax and Compliance Division in Salem. The permanent full-time position pays $4,312 to $5,988 per month and closes August 23, 2026.

The employee will join Return Review Team 2 and work directly with personal income-tax accounts. Although the classification is administrative, the day-to-day job requires tax-return review, taxpayer communication, case analysis and judgment about filing and credit issues.

Reviewing Tax Returns

The specialist reviews and computes amended personal income-tax returns, including accounts converted from the state’s legacy tax system. That can require comparing return data, account history and supporting information before deciding whether an adjustment is needed.

The employee also uses specialized systems to verify or adjust suspended returns for taxpayers with different residency statuses.

Contact With Taxpayers and Representatives

Some cases cannot be completed with the information already on file. The specialist contacts taxpayers, tax practitioners and attorneys by phone or mail to request missing documents or clarification.

Clear communication matters because the employee needs to explain what information is required while keeping the case accurate and professionally documented.

Compliance and Tax-Law Decisions

The role includes analyzing whether a taxpayer is in return-filing compliance under agency policy. The specialist can also evaluate whether a taxpayer or preparer knowingly claimed a credit for which they were not eligible.

Individual cases may require interpretation of federal, state and local tax law. Attention to detail and sound judgment are therefore central to the position.

Minimum Qualifications

Applicants can qualify with three years of secretarial or administrative support experience that includes coordinating office procedures, preparing narrative or statistical reports and collecting or analyzing administrative data.

Another route is an associate degree in general office occupations plus two years of the same type of experience. An equivalent combination of education and experience can also qualify.

Hybrid Work and Benefits

The job is headquartered in Salem, but an eligible employee may be allowed to work in an in-state hybrid arrangement. Oregon DOR generally requires candidates to reside in Oregon, subject to the exceptions stated in the current recruitment.

State benefits include medical, dental and vision coverage, retirement programs, holidays, personal business leave, vacation and sick leave, plus optional programs such as disability coverage and deferred compensation.
